We are looking for engineers to join our Content Delivery team. Do you love to build massive, distributed, and amazing systems? Are you passionate about open source software, and building systems using it? Do you like to add immediate, tangible business value

As an engineer in the CDN team, you will help build the infrastructure and develop software to support the systems that deliver IP content for a wide range of mobile and first-screen television devices. As part of the larger Comcast engineering teams, you will help shape the next generation of IP content delivery and transform the customer experience.

Using the tenets of DevOps, you will have the opportunity to own the entire stack, from architecture to production.

Responsibilities:

• Design new software applications, support applications under development, and customize existing applications.

• Develop software update process for existing applications. Assist in the rollout of software releases.

• Collaborate with project stakeholders to identify product and technical requirements. Conducts analysis to determine integration needs.

• Diagnose performance issues and propose and implement code improvements

• Ensure the software architecture is lean and extensible

• Ensure software modules are reliable for reuse

• Work with Quality Assurance team to determine if applications fit specification and technical requirements.

Here are some of the specific technologies we use for Traffic Control:

-Go (golang)
-C
-C++
-Java
-Linux (CentoOS)
-Git
-Apache httpd
-Perl
-InfluxDB
-Redis
-OpenStack

Experience / Skills


Preferred Skills:

-An open mind and a passion for coding excellence
-BS in Computer Science and 8+ years equivalent experience
-Experience in OO programming languages Java or C/C++. Experience with GoLang highly desired
-Knowledge of Object Design, Design patterns, and Algorithms
-Experience developing software for Networking, Web services, DNS, HTTP, and TCP/IP
-Good communicator; able to analyze and clearly articulate complex issues and technologies understandably and engagingly
-Great design and problem-solving skills, with a strong bias for architecting at scale
-Strong troubleshooting and problem-solving skills, adaptable, proactive and willing to take ownership